Para información en español llamar al (512) 635-1036. 4 STEPS GUIDELINE ACCORDING TO THE DIOCESE OF AUSTIN FOR THOSE PREPARING FOR MARRIAGE: 1) Couples should contact their priest at least six months prior to wedding date. 2) Couples must take a premarital inventory, The FOCCUS. 3) Couples must attend a retreat or take a formal marriage preparation course, “Together In God’s Love.” 4) Couples must take at least a one-hour introduction to Natural Family Planning (full course preferred). Couples must be responsible to contact the office of Family Life 512-949-2495 regarding to item 3 &4.

Quick Questions What does the phrase "binding and loosing," as mentioned in Matthew 16:19 and Matthew 18:18, refer to? Answer: "Binding and loosing" is a phrase which comes from the rabbis. It refers to the authority to make decisions binding on the people of God.

This authority includes interpreting and applying the Word of God and admitting people to and excommunicating them from the community of faith. For the Jews this meant the community of Israel. For Christians this means the Church.

In Matthew 16:19 Jesus gives this authority over his Church to Peter: "Whatever you bind on Earth shall be bound in heaven; and whatever you loose on Earth shall be loosed in heaven."

In Matthew 18:18, he gives the power to all the apostles: "Amen, I say to you, whatever you bind on Earth shall be bound in heaven, and whatever you loose on Earth shall be loosed in heaven."

This singling out of Peter to bestow on him an authority which is later to be given to all the apostles shows Peter's preeminence within the apostolic college. What the apostles as a whole possessed as leaders of the Church, Peter possessed as an individual.

Of course, he, as the earthly head of the Church, also possessed powers which all the other apostles, even collectively, didn't possess: "I will give you the keys of the kingdom of heaven" (Mt 16:19). Answered by: Catholic Answers Staff
